Requirements for DPSA Professional Surveyor :-
Applicants must be in possession of a Grade 12 Certificate and Bachelor of Science Degree in Survey / Geomatics. Compulsory registration with South African Geomatics Council (SAGC) as Professional Surveyor on appointment. Compulsory registration with South African Geomatics Council (SAGC) as Professional Land Surveyor to perform cadastral surveys. Minimum of 3 years post qualification survey experience. Job related knowledge: Programme and project management. Survey design and analysis knowledge. Research and development. Computeraided survey applications. Knowledge of legal compliance. Creating high performance culture. Technical report writing. Networking. Professional judgement. Job related skills: Decision making skills, Team leadership skills, Analytical skills, Creativity skills, Self-management skills, Financial 6 management skills, Customer focus and responsiveness, Communication skills (verbal and written), Computer literacy, Planning and organising, Conflict management skills, Problem solving analysis skills, People management skills, Change management skills and Innovation skills. A valid driver’s licence.
